A Real Podcast in a Late-Night Car: Listening to Two Women Talk About the Other Side of Adulthood
It was a typical night, and I thought it was going to be a normal date. But when I saw my date bring her girlfriend along, I couldn't help but feel a little disappointed. After all, this wasn't what I had expected. However, things didn't go as I had anticipated.
From the moment they got in the car to the end of the night, over the course of 90 minutes, I found myself becoming more and more like a listener. The two women were chatting away, and I was just an accompaniment, a mere spectator. The content of their conversation was getting increasingly absurd, as if we had entered a world beyond my wildest imagination.
Her girlfriend was talking about her experience with online dating, about how she had traveled to another city to meet her online friend, only to discover that the other person didn't even know how to use a navigation app. Then, she started talking about the time she lived in a trendy LOFT apartment, and how there were all sorts of crazy stories, including someone who got reported by their neighbors for being too loud, and eventually, the police showed up. Each story was like a little bombshell, shocking me to my core.
As time went on, the conversation turned to their experiences working in a government agency and within the system. Some of the stories made me finally understand why many people present one image on social media, but are completely different in real life. It's as if everyone is wearing a mask, and only at night can they reveal their true selves.
That 90-minute car ride was like a real podcast. I was just the driver, and they were the ones telling me about the other side of adulthood, bit by bit. No script, no acting, just real conversations and stories.
